Hand,Knife,Stick,Gun workshop a great time in Lambertville!   Message List

Hey gang the workshop in Historic Lambertville NJ, was great! The 2
days were perfect weather. The location ws amazing ontop of and old
historic firehouse. the turnout was kinda smaller than expected but
that worked well in our faver. That meant the more direct attention
we got from Hock W. Hochiem himself. Two martial arts friends Becky
Sheetz and Howard Spivey whom I know from a martial arts website that
we moderate (Karatekorner.com) came to the worskshop on my
recommendation. They crashed with me in Bensalem after the first day,
which covered primarily from a stick perspective, tactics verses
hand, knife, stick and gun. The 2nd day was from a knife perspective
of basically the same thing without the gun emphasis. The gun
material was quite impressive and different, working with wooden
rubberband shooting gun, which seemed silly at first but revealed to
be quite a fun and effective teaching tool, now I want to get some
guns for my own class. I definately recommend this workshop and can't
wait to attend again!
